What is Legionella?
Understanding the Risks and Responsibilities

Legionella is a type of bacteria found naturally in water environments such as rivers, lakes, and reservoirs. In these natural settings, it is typically present in low numbers and does not pose a significant risk to human health. However, problems arise when Legionella enters man-made water systems where conditions allow it to multiply and spread. Understanding what Legionella is, how it develops, and how it is controlled is essential for any organisation responsible for managing water systems.

Where Legionella Grows

Legionella bacteria thrive in specific conditions, particularly in water systems where temperatures and environmental factors support growth. The bacteria multiply most rapidly in water temperatures between 20°C and 45°C, especially where water is stagnant or poorly maintained.

Common locations where Legionella can develop include:

  • Hot and cold water systems
  • Storage tanks and calorifiers
  • Showers and taps
  • Cooling towers and evaporative condensers
  • Spa pools and hot tubs
  • Pipework with low flow or dead legs

Other contributing factors include the presence of scale, sludge, rust, and biofilm, which provide nutrients and protection for bacteria to grow. Systems that are not regularly used or maintained are particularly vulnerable.

How Does Legionella Spread?

Legionella does not spread through drinking water. Instead, it becomes a risk when small droplets of contaminated water (aerosols) are inhaled into the lungs.

These aerosols can be created by:

  • Showers and spray taps
  • Cooling systems
  • Spa pools and hot tubs
  • Air conditioning systems
  • Any system that generates fine water droplets

Once inhaled, the bacteria can infect the respiratory system, potentially leading to serious illness.

What Does Legionella Cause?

The most serious illness caused by Legionella is Legionnaires’ disease, a type of pneumonia that can be severe and, in some cases, fatal.

Symptoms typically develop within 2 to 10 days of exposure and may include:

  • High fever
  • Cough (dry or productive)
  • Shortness of breath
  • Muscle aches
  • Headaches
  • Fatigue
  • In some cases, confusion or gastrointestinal symptoms

Legionnaires’ disease requires prompt medical treatment, usually with antibiotics. Early diagnosis is important to reduce the risk of complications.

Who is Most at Risk?

While anyone can be affected, certain groups are at a higher risk of developing severe illness from Legionella exposure:

  • People over the age of 45
  • Smokers and heavy drinkers
  • Individuals with respiratory conditions
  • Those with weakened immune systems
  • People with chronic illnesses such as diabetes or kidney disease

In environments such as hospitals and care homes, the risk is significantly higher due to the vulnerability of occupants.

Legal Responsibilities
and Regulations

In the UK, Legionella control is governed by a clear legal framework that places responsibility on those who manage or control water systems.

The Health and Safety at Work etc. Act 1974 requires organisations to ensure the safety of employees and others who may be affected by their activities. In the context of water systems, this includes managing the risk of Legionella.

The Control of Substances Hazardous to Health Regulations (COSHH) classifies Legionella as a hazardous biological agent. This means organisations must assess the risk of exposure and implement suitable control measures.

The key guidance documents supporting compliance are:

ACOP L8
(Legionnaires’ disease: The control of Legionella bacteria in water systems)

This sets out the legal expectations for managing Legionella risk, including the requirement for a risk assessment, appointment of responsible persons, and implementation of a written scheme of control.

HSG274

This provides detailed technical guidance on how to manage different types of water systems, including hot and cold systems, cooling towers, and other risk areas, in line with ACOP L8. HSG274 is broken down into 3 separate parts, Part 1 covers evaporative cooling systems, such as cooling towers, Part 2 deals with hot and cold water systems, and Part 3 addresses all other risk systems, such as spa pools and misting equipment.

HTM 04-01
(Health Technical Memorandum 04-01)

This applies to healthcare environments such as hospitals and clinical settings. It builds on ACOP L8 and HSG274, setting more stringent standards for water safety management due to the vulnerability of patients, including enhanced monitoring and tighter control measures.

HSG282

This specifically applies to spa pools and hot tubs, where the risk of Legionella is significantly higher. It outlines stricter requirements for monitoring, cleaning, disinfection, and water quality control due to the increased risk from aerosol generation and warm water conditions.

Together, these regulations and guidance documents form the recognised standard for Legionella control in the UK. Organisations must ensure they understand and apply the relevant guidance based on their specific systems and environments, with the Legionella risk assessment acting as the foundation for compliance.

How is Legionella Prevented?

Preventing Legionella requires a structured and proactive approach to water system management. The foundation of this is a Legionella risk assessment, which identifies potential risks and defines the control measures required. Key prevention methods include:

Temperature Control

  • Keeping hot water above 60°C at storage and 50°C at outlets (55°C for healthcare premises)
  • Keeping cold water below 20°C

Regular Flushing

  • Preventing stagnation by flushing infrequently used outlets

Cleaning and Disinfection

  • Regular cleaning of tanks, pipework, and outlets
  • Periodic system disinfection where required

Routine Monitoring

  • Temperature checks and system inspections
  • Ensuring control measures remain effective

Water Sampling and Testing

  • Microbiological testing to verify system control

System Maintenance

  • Removing dead legs and unused pipework
  • Ensuring systems are designed and maintained correctly

These measures work together to create conditions where Legionella cannot grow or spread.
